In this issue we highlight the Cereus Fund, Trees Foundation's largest and longest-running donor-advised grantor. Over the past eleven years, the Cereus Fund has contributed hundreds of thousands of dollars to grassroots environmental projects throughout the redwood region. Showcasing the ability of one person to make a lasting difference, the Cereus Fund has helped enable restoration and preservation throughout California's North Coast.
With a focus on grassroots solutions and sustainable communities, the Cereus Fund donor has empowered a wide range of strategies and tactics as part of a vision of holistic recovery for our globally unique north coast. More than one hundred projects have benefited from the vision and commitment of the Cereus Fund, especially Trees Foundation itself.
Many of the projects you read about in every issue of Forest and River News, including this issue, have benefited from this individual donor's dedication and generosity. On behalf of the forests, rivers, wildlife, and grassroots activists of the north coast--we offer our sincere gratitude.
